India lost the first match of the year. A partnership of 242 runs between George Bailey and Steve Smith has made Indian bowler look like pedestrian. India’s best spinner Ravichandran Ashwin proved too much in the middle of the action. As Steve Smith and George Bailey reached their respective hundred they onslaught Indian bowlers.
Bailey scored 112 before caught in the long on in a bid to hit six. Rohit Sharma hit a brilliant 171. But his record-breaking has gone in vain as Steve Smith and Bailey snatched the match away the match from India.
However, India got a brilliant start from debutant bowler Barinder Sran who sent back both Australian opener Aaron Finch and David Warner. But, Bailey and Smith changed the course of the match with brilliant centuries. Sran took three wickets including the wicket of Steve Smith who scored 149.
